Sulfate-free shampoos have actually obtained appeal in recent years, especially amongst individuals with curly hair. Curly hair is often much more susceptible to dryness, frizz, and damages, so making use of the right items, including sulfate-free shampoos, can use numerous benefits. Here are several of the benefits of using sulfate-free hair shampoos for curly hair: Sulfates are harsh detergents discovered in several conventional shampoos.


Sulfate Free ShampooSulfate Free Shampoo
Sulfate-free hair shampoos are milder and do not overly disrupt the hair's natural moisture equilibrium. Sulfate-free shampoos are much less likely to strip the hair of its all-natural oils. This can help in reducing frizz, as well-hydrated hair is less vulnerable to flyaways and frizz, which is a common concern for lots of individuals with curly hair.


Curly hair is normally drier than straight hair because the scalp's natural oils have a harder time taking a trip down the hair shaft. If you have color-treated curly hair, sulfate-free hair shampoos are gentler on the hair and can assist preserve your hair color for a longer duration.

The function of these sulfates is to produce a lathering impact to remove oil and dust from your hair. If your shampoo easily makes a soap in the shower, there's an excellent chance it consists of sulfates.


Contrasted to other cleaning ingredients in shampoo, sulfates are claimed to have the. Sulfates are thought about shampooing staples.




This doesn't imply that sulfate-containing hair shampoo is safe or suitable for every person. It can be damaging to specific types of hair, and it may also create skin irritation in some individuals.


You may not respond well to sulfates if you have delicate skin or hair, or if you have any allergic reactions or sensitivities to these types of chemicals. This is since the component is located to aggravate skin with rosacea and might lead to symptoms on your scalp as well as on your face, shoulders, and back.
